Output 51b4b1081aa8d05639947fa186f39956e93b0db2540af852ebddf1fe03157163:0

value
11899492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ef5356e18b220104d6d4717948ca339acdc3c72 OP_EQUAL
address
3AM7ByYgeWLSxA6i7JJPQ9hSSyRn2QdHLS
transaction
51b4b1081aa8d05639947fa186f39956e93b0db2540af852ebddf1fe03157163
spent
true